I assure you that at all of the character dining restaurants, there is always something on the adult menu I like.
Most character dining restaurants are buffet or all-you-care-to-eat style, which is nice since you can pick and choose what you want to eat. Restaurants like Chef Mickey's in the Contemporary Resort have a special kids section that features pizza, Mickey mac n cheese, chicken tenders and fries. Chef Mickey's is my favorite for character dining. You're also pretty safe at any breakfast as well. The standard eggs, pancakes, waffles, pastries and fruit can be found anywhere. I recommend Crystal Palace in the Magic Kingdom or Tusker House in the Animal Kingdom for breakfast. This isn't a character meal, but I highly recommend 'Ohana in the Polynesian Resort for dinner.
